Subject: Cut-over complete — token refresh fix

Hi — the Gullwharf cut-over finished cleanly last night. The session-token refresh bug is gone: tokens now renew before expiry instead of after, so the midnight logout storm shouldn't recur. No rollbacks were needed and error rates stayed flat. For your review, the auth service now runs with the following configuration.

settings of yaguf-bahip:
druwyn:
  log_level: debug
  metrics_host: metrics.druwyn.qorvelsys.internal
  pool_size: 32

# Crashfunnel pipeline env — review checklist
# Ingests crash reports from the Lumabird mobile apps, dedupes, and ships
# symbolicated traces to the Ashgrove dashboard.
# Verify: retention is 30d, sampling stays at 1.0 for release builds,
# and symbol upload targets the prod bucket, not staging.
# Do not commit this file. The pipeline authenticates to the symbol
# store via the credential on the line that follows.

secret setting of kawif-haweg: COURIER_KEY8=0cf7bc02

**14:22** — Rolled the Fareglide ticket-pricing experiment to 25% of traffic. Almost immediately, checkout conversions dipped because the discount banner cached the old price tier. Heads up for new folks: always bust the banner cache before ramping. We reverted within nine minutes. The offending build can be looked up with the token below.

session token of yajof-bagef = htk4_937d

Q: How do night-shift colleagues handle guests needing Wi-Fi after hours? A: The guest Wi-Fi desk at the Pellman Court reception is unstaffed from 22:00. Log the visitor in the overnight book, confirm their host, and issue a voucher from the locked drawer. The drawer keypad code for the night shift is below.

turnstile pass: bdg-YPPQB-52010